During the Tilburg Dance Week the new inflatable Mobile Dance House will make its first appearance, on the Heuvel square, right in the centre of Tilburg, and it will serve as a central information point for the Tilburg Dance Week. Aside from offering you all the information about the programme for the Dance Week, it will also form the backdrop for three dance duologues. Arts journalist Rinus van der Heijden will be moderating three conversations between choreographers and artists from other disciplines.

6 October 12.00: Dance Duologue with Koen Augustijnen and Guy Cools
‘Ashes’, by the Belgian company Les Ballets C de la B, has been a triumph ever since its premiere in February of this year, touring the European theatres. Set to music by the baroque composer G.F. Händel, choreographer Koen Augustijnen has created a unique performance for eight dancers and acrobats, two singers, and five musicians. Moderator Rinus van der Heijden would like to find out more from the choreographer and from dramaturge Guy Cools, who has been closely involved in the production. The audience will have ample opportunity to ask questions during this evening.
